test(cliproxy): add unit tests for quota fetchers and auth utilities
Add comprehensive unit tests for: - buildCodexQuotaWindows(): window parsing, clamping, reset time calculation - buildGeminiCliBuckets(): bucket grouping, model series, token types - resolveGeminiCliProjectId(): project ID extraction from account field - sanitizeEmail(): email to filename conversion - isTokenExpired(): token expiry validation Also removes unused 'preferred' field from GEMINI_CLI_GROUPS (YAGNI) 39 new tests covering edge cases: - Percentage clamping (0-100, 0-1) - Missing/null fields - camelCase/snake_case API responses - Empty inputs - Invalid date strings Addresses code review feedback on PR #395
